[PATCH 10/67 v2] staging: comedi: pcl812: remove 'ai_data_len' from private data

H Hartley Sweeten hsweeten at visionengravers.com
Tue Mar 4 18:29:30 UTC 2014


This member of the private data is only used in the initial dma setup.
Refactor that code to not need it and remove the member.
